Prompt Engineer: професія майбутнього чи обов’язковий скіл?
Ще рік тому бізнес сприймав технології ШІ з обережністю. Сьогодні ж за даними McKinsey понад 65% компаній регулярно використовують GenAI (генеративний штучний інтелект) – це вдвічі більше за значення із дослідження, яке проводили наприкінці минулого року.
Довіра до ШІ шириться світом, а разом із тим ми все частіше чуємо про раніше невідомі професії та ролі. Серед таких новостворених позицій – Prompt Engineer.
Хтось вважає, що створення промптів – це навичка, а не окрема професія. Інші ж вірять у перспективність цього напрямку та в майбутній попит на окремих спеціалістів. То що ж це за новий вид інженерів? Чи є потенціал у цієї професії? І зрештою як навчитися писати вдалі промпти?
У цій статті ти знайдеш відповіді на всі запитання. А розібратися з цією темою нам допомогла дослідниця Єнського університету, консультантка з напряму NLP/ML у CHI Software – Ольга Каніщева.
Що таке Prompt Engineering?
Першочергово звернемося до Кембридзького словника, в якому вже знайшов своє місце цей термін:
Prompt Engineering – це процес розробки підказок (промптів) природною мовою, які людина дає штучному інтелекту з метою отримати найкращі результати або відповіді.
«Слід зазначити, що prompt engineering – не про просто спілкування з моделлю генеративного ШІ (Generative AI), а prompt – не лише запит. Це створення певних рамок або фреймів для запитання, які нам допоможуть отримати максимально корисну відповідь від моделі.
Prompt Engineering стосується не лише генерації текстових відповідей, а й будь-якого контенту: зображення, відео, звуки, програмний код, схеми й діаграми, презентації – і це тільки сьогодні. Хто знає, до яких масштабів цей список розшириться протягом наступних років».
Логічно припустити, що за процесом створення промптів стоїть конкретна професія. Проте не все так просто.
Хто такий Prompt Engineer (і чи існує він насправді)?
Перші згадки про Prompt Engineer-ів як окрему професію з’явилися тільки рік тому. Програма Google Trends зафіксувала неабиякий бум запитів у квітні 2023.
Натомість досі неможливо без суперечності визначити, хто ж такий насправді Prompt-інженер та який у нього скоуп обов’язків. Але інтуїтивно, з уже вивченого вище, можна сконструювати нове поняття:
Prompt Engineer – це інженер, який розробляє підказки для штучного інтелекту, щоб отримати найкращі результати від моделі GenAI.
Що про це думає наша експертка?
«На мій погляд, сьогодні Prompt Engineer – це розкручений термін. Як рік тому, так і зараз кажуть, що він перетвориться на повноцінну окрему професію. Проте кожна вакансія чи стаття все більше переконує в тому, що це не так. Prompt Engineering є навичкою, яка потрібна будь-якому спеціалісту. Тож окремо створювати людину, яка писатиме промпти, недоречно».
Яка ситуація на ринку Prompt-професій?
Попри те, що сьогодні складно розшукати справжніх володарів цієї професії, відповідні вакансії трапляються на деяких платформах із пошуку роботи.
Наприклад, Glassdoor на момент написання цієї статті містить 21 вакансію із заголовками, схожими на «Prompt Engineer», а на Upwork створено близько тридцяти таких запитів.
Проте слід бути уважним до подібних кар’єрних знахідок й уважно читати список обов’язків.
«Якщо більш глибоко зануритися у вакансії з припискою «AI», можна побачити, що вміння писати промпти зазначається як додатковий скіл або ж не єдиний серед списку. Промпти можуть написати будь-які розробники й інженери.
Скіл «Prompt Engineering» у сучасних вакансіях не означає, що ти будеш займатися цим протягом п’яти років. Звертайся до таких вакансій глибше й зрозумій, що, можливо, ринок конструювання промптів дуже швидко зміниться. Тож не потрібно концентруватися на Prompt Engineering-у як на основній діяльності. Але тренувати скіл створення запитів для ШІ ще й як корисно, навіть необхідно. Причому багатьом спеціалістам», – зазначає Ольга Каніщева.
Кому може знадобитися навичка побудови промптів?
«Перелік професій, яким може знадобитися Prompt Engineering, неосяжний. Проте я спробую назвати ключові.
Почнемо з людей, які на професійному рівні мають часто листуватися: Sales-менеджери, HR-и, рекрутери тощо. Припуститися лексичної, пунктуаційної або ж граматичної помилки, обрати хибний тон листа дуже просто, хоча від цього може залежати подальша комунікація з важливим клієнтом чи співробітником. Допомогти уникнути неточностей у листуванні може генеративний штучний інтелект. Це справжній must have.
Prompt Engineering потрібно розвивати й тим, хто працює з документацією: маркетологам, Project-менеджерам, Product-менеджерам, Scrum-майстрам, Tech-райтерам. Для цих професій інструменти GenAI допомагають під час доповідей, створення презентацій, написання контенту, дизайну.
Авжеж цей скіл обов’язковий для розробників. Є дуже багато інструментів, які допомагають писати код швидше й припускатися меншої кількості помилок.
Цей список можна продовжувати до нескінченності, адже для будь-якого домену можливо знайти унікальний запит, який задовольнить ШІ. Усе залежить від людини – довіряє вона новітнім технологіям чи ні. Хоче вона розвинути свої навички й покращити відповіді GenAI-моделі або ж прагне залишити все, як є».
Як побудувати промпт, щоб Chat GPT зрозумів мене?
«Майстерність будувати промпти повинна прийти з практикою. Проте є певні рекомендації, яких уже зараз можна дотримуватися, щоб розвиватися за правильним напрямком.
Промпт має бути чітким й однозначним. Перевір свій запит на людині: якщо вона поставить у відповідь запитання-уточнення, це означає, що промпт потрібно вдосконалити. Модель своєю чергою не питатиме. Вона, як дуже відповідальна людина, буде виконувати, а ти отримаєш результат – якісний або не дуже.
Промпт має бути конкретним. Тут краще один раз побачити приклад конкретного промпту, ніж занурюватися в теорію. Ділимося якісним шаблоном:
Сформуй таблицю вчених, які займалися вивченням методів штучного інтелекту з 1990 по 2024 роки для домену медицини. Перший стовпець – ім’я та прізвище вченого, Другий стовпець – посада вченого. Третій стовпець – область вивчення ШІ для медицини.
У цьому запиті ми вказали максимум вимог до результату:
- суть завдання
- часовий проміжок
- тематику (домен)
- формат відповіді
- очікуваний результат.
Тож чим більше конкретики ти даси Чату, тим ближчу до своїх очікувань відповідь ти отримаєш – усе просто!
Промпт може містити приклад. Уяви, що в тебе вже є текст листа, який ти маєш вдосконалити й додати до структури один абзац. Надішли цей лист ШІ-інструменту як приклад і попроси згенерувати такий самий лист, тільки додати до змісту абзац з описом твоєї компанії. Коли модель побачить приклад, їй стане набагато легше виконати твій запит. І скоріш за все ти отримаєш гідний результат (авжеж, якщо дотримаєшся пунктів вище 😉).
Крізь невдалі промпти й недовіру до штучного інтелекту треба себе привчити правильно писати запити, адже це прямий шлях до автоматизації скіла й полегшення роботи в майбутньому».
Чи втримається Prompt Engineering на ринку як окрема професія? Скоріш за все ні. А от як навичка побудова промптів стане конкурентною перевагою для багатьох спеціалістів в ІТ та за його межами. Тож не марнуй час, тренуй свої скіли в побудові якісних запитів і головне – не бійся експериментувати з промптами. Адже поки ти не використовуєш Prompt Engineering, ти не знаєш, наскільки він може тобі допомогти.
курси, які можуть тебе зацікавити
Цей матеріал ще ніхто не прокоментував
Може, ти станеш першим?